I have tried Match.com multiple times, for a long period of time. I have spent hundreds of dollars using Match.com's paid subscription. The site has become worse and worse as years have gone by. They have made the site more difficult to navigate through. It is harder to see who has messaged you. It used to be that you had a mailbox and if someone sent you a message it was just like an email going into your email mailbox. You could read it and respond. Now it is different, and it no longer works that way. The whole site is more confusing. It is not that you can't figure it out, but it is not as user friendly, and not as easy as it used to be. Now match.com has changed their policy on reviewing other people's profiles as a non paid member. Now you can only see 6 profiles, and the rest are not viewable if you do not have a paid subscription.
What is match.com hiding? Are they hiding the fact that they do not believe that they have enough "real" profiles on their site to convince someone to pay for a subscription? Match.com author review by Mark Brooks
Match.com is one of the biggest and best-known online dating sites in the United States. It has been helping singles find partners since 1995, it now serves people in over 24 countries with sites in 15 different languages.
Profiles may include several photos: Users can provide photos of themselves in various settings as well both full-length photos and headshots to provide the most accurate information about themselves for potential matches.
Advanced search algorithm: Users can choose both physical and value-based attributes to search for, improving the quality of the matches they find.
Anonymous email network: Users can email potential matches through Match.com's own messaging service, allowing them to keep their identities and contact info private until they are ready to share it
Partners with sites in various countries: Match.com partners with personal ad sites in several countries so that international users can find their perfect match.
Profiles are screened before being posted: Match.com staff screens profiles and photos before posting to ensure only appropriate information makes it onto the site.
